FRANCE-MUSIC-HALLYDAY-TRIBUTE

Former French President Nicolas Sarkozy signs the condolence book as he arrives at La Madeleine Church for the funeral ceremony in tribute to late French singer Johnny Hallyday on December 9, 2017 in Paris. French music icon Johnny Hallyday died on December 6, 2017 aged 74 after a battle with lung cancer, plunging the country into mourning for a national treasure whose soft rock lit up the lives of three generations.
